Sessions announced $750,000 in federal funding he secured for Pflugerville’s Pump Station and Storage Tank Project. The funding was included in H.R. 6938, which passed both chambers and was signed into law on January 23, 2026. The release says the project will protect public health and support safe, reliable water service.
Congress.gov lists Rep. Pete Sessions as sponsor of H.R.7270, introduced January 27, 2026. The latest action is referral to House committees, and the tracker status is Introduced.
Assessments
Sessions can receive same-term credit for securing enacted federal funding for Pflugerville water infrastructure that supports public health and safe water service. That is a concrete safety-related result, but it addresses only one slice of a broad promise covering persons, families, neighborhoods, schools, and the defenseless. His identity-fraud bill was introduced and referred but had not passed, so it adds effort rather than full delivery.
